- Top - left image: The process is Mitosis. Mitosis is a type of cell division that results in two daughter cells each having the same number and kind of chromosomes as the parent nucleus, typical of ordinary tissue growth.
- Top - right image: The process is Sexual Reproduction/Fertilization. Fertilization is the union of a sperm and an egg cell, forming a zygote.
- Bottom - left image: The process is Crossing Over. Crossing over is the exchange of genetic material between non - sister chromatids of homologous chromosomes during meiosis, leading to genetic recombination.
- Bottom - right image: The process is Meiosis. Meiosis is a type of cell division that reduces the chromosome number by half, resulting in four daughter cells (gametes in animals), each with half the number of chromosomes of the parent cell.
